Travellers can choose from various train types, such as IC Intercity, which dominates with 66% of services, offering tickets from PLN 25. For those who prefer faster connections, EIP Pendolino trains are available, which account for 16% of services, with prices starting from PLN 71. The cheapest option is InterRegio trains, with tickets from PLN 14.
Kraków is the most frequently chosen destination, with a journey time of 2h 41min for the fastest connections. Other popular destinations are Gdańsk (9% share) and Wrocław (5% share), with journey times of 2h 18min and 3h 27min respectively.
Tickets for travel from Warsaw Służewiec are most often purchased 1–3 days before departure, accounting for 34% of all bookings, with an average ticket price of PLN 89.
